Ingredients

3 large ripe bananas

1/2 cup creamy Old Home Peanut Butter, divided

1 1/2 cup whole milk, or milk of choice

1/4 cup maple syrup

2 tsp vanilla extract

2 eggs

3 cups rolled oats

1/2 cup cocoa powder

1 tsp kosher salt

1/2 cup mini chocolate chips plus more topping

Directions

Preheat oven to 350 Degrees F. In a large bowl mash bananas. Add milk, eggs, vanilla extract, and half the peanut butter. Whisk until combined. Add your oats, cocoa powder and salt. Mis until everything is combined. Stir in chocolate chips. Pour into a 13×9 greased baking dish. Drizzle with remaining peanut butter and an extra sprinkle of chocolate chips. Bake for 25-30 minutes. Cut into squares. Eat warm or refrigerate. These could be eaten cold or heated for a warm breakfast.
